python_appnium之关于安装nodejs中npm运行报错(6)
关于上一篇python_appnium之安装下载nodejs(5)后安装npm总是报错,于是查找各种方法解决,最终发现是由于多个问题导致
①运行npm-v命令时发现此情况,是由于node是最新的,但是安装的nodejs中的npm的版本没有相应的更新存在版本滞后导致问题出现
在nodejs文件夹中找到npm.cmd文件修改 prefix-g 为 prefix –location=global
②在创建完成node_cache、node_global文件后,验证是否成功安装时,出现以下报错:
只需找到node_cache、node_global文件属性打开所有权限,点击“应用”按钮后,点击“确定”按钮,以免由于没有权限导致无法使用文档而报错
node_global文件也进行如下操作:
③再次验证时出现此问题
使用powershell 更改版本,我这边就是在更改版本后成功的,以防由于版本过低导致问题出现
使用命令set-ExecutionPolicy RemoteSigned回车
输入Y
输入命令npm-windows-upgrade
选择版本8.12.1回车
成功后使用cmd 输入命令 npm install express -g 运行试验是否成功安装npm,成功如下图